5.5. Daylight Dimming
5.5.1. Introduction
This feature allows us to utilize external daylight that is coming into the space and reduce the light output of any luminaire to enhance energy efficiency.
You can either enable or disable daylight dimming with existing calibration or
Manually calibrate and enable daylight dimming by adjusting the light output of a luminaire.
5.5.2. Configuration
5.5.2.1. Enable with Current Calibration
Toggle relay on for whole zone or off for selected node only
Press Enable to enable daylight dimming.
Press Disable to disable daylight dimming.
Press Query to get the current status
5.5.2.1. Calibrate & Enable (Recommended)
Dim a luminaire to desired output by following temporary dimming shared earlier.
Now click on “Calibrate and Enable”
Allow you 3 seconds to move out of the field of view before it takes a light reading and calibrates the Response Sensor Node for this level of light. We recommend doing this for each individual luminaire separately if you are enabling this feature the first time.
By default, daylight dimming is disabled for all the nodes.
